Output 7145009625bb40a1752856fde0beb5d4eaa9544801e89764055b0bdb4e5bc507:0

value
500045310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0f1ddd3f5ac9815edd4ec3539cc25f6fbf833bf OP_EQUAL
address
3HpcbV9Dok4693r8TFK1AF14P8aCsjzVvb
transaction
7145009625bb40a1752856fde0beb5d4eaa9544801e89764055b0bdb4e5bc507
spent
true